Berman and Sherman on 'Which Way, LA?'

By Kevin Roderick | April 3, 2012 9:45 AM

Warren Olney will host a little radio debate tonight between the Valley congressmen who are running against each other, Rep. Howard Berman and Rep. Brad Sherman. It's on "Which Way, LA?" tonight at 7 p.m. on KCRW.
